DEFINITION

Myeloperoxidase (745 aa, ~84 kDa) is encoded by the human MPO gene. This protein is involved in the regulation of the innate host defense through the production of hypohalous acids.

DesignNote

Myeloperoxidase is synthesized as a single chain precursor that is cleaved into a light and heavy chain. The mature enzyme is a tetramer composed of 2 light chains and 2 heavy chains. (EntrezGene)
